The woman holding the Guinness world record for having the longest fingernails has finally cut off her nails.

The US-based lady whose name is Ayanna Williams and lives in Houston, Texas became a worldwide name when she was named the Guinness World Record holder for the world’s longest finger nails in 2017.

At that time, her fingernails measured nearly 19 feet long and she revealed that she hasn’t cut these nails for three decades.

Well, it seems she is tired as she took them off over the weekend and prior to her cutting these ‘devil-like’ nails, they measured was 24 ft, 0.7 in.

Per reports, she used about three to four bottles of nail polish and over 20 hours to do her manicure before these nails were finally cut off. She got rid of the named at a dermatology office in Fort Worth, Texas.

In her submission, she said;

“With or without my nails, I will still be the queen. My nails don’t make me, I make my nails!”

She, however, revealed plans to only grow her nails about six inches, and this is according to a report by Ripley’s Believe It or Not!, which will display her trimmed nails at its museum in Orlando, Florida.

Prior to her cutting the nails, Williams was unable to do some activities, such as washing the dishes and putting sheets on a bed and according to her, her new goal is to encourage the next history-making nail enthusiast to go for a Guinness World Records title.
